Pepsi introduces Social Vending Machines, lets you gift drinks

By: Aseem Gaurav, April 30, 2011

Food and beverage giant PepsiCo, which is well known for its interactive marketing campaigns, has launched a new vending machine that can send gift drinks to your friends and even record messages.

PepsiCo’s Social Vending Machine, which the company recently launched at a trade show in Chicago, combines the traditional vending with modern day social networking.



To use the vending machine choose a drink of your choice for your friend, and give the machine the friend's name and mobile number. Consumers can personalize the message with a short video recorded by the machine along with a personalized text message. Moreover, you can even send a free beverage to a stranger.

Your friend on the other hand can go to any vending machine that is linked, enter the code from the text message and receive the drink. Even your friend can pass it on to someone else.

Mikel Durham, chief innovation officer at PepsiCo Foodservice, in a statement said: “The new machine “extends our consumers’ social networks beyond the confines of their own devices and transforms a static, transaction-oriented experience into something fun.”

However to the surprise of many, Pepsi’s model for social vending machines lack the popular networking giants like Twitter or Facebook, but the company says there is a possibility to other social media integration in the near future.
